Hi Gene Fighter,
I'm in the same boat as you are. I'm 24 and I've been losing my hair since I was 17.
About a year ago I saw a coalition surgeon about an HT, he recommended that I go on the Rogaine foam and Propecia in a year, and see what the results are.
I've had no problems with either product in that, I have been fortunate to not have experienced any of the side-effects. I've filled in some at the vertex of my head, and I believe I've stopped the hair loss.
I took photos prior to using the products and I look A LOT better now, than a year ago.
Give it a shot Gene Fighter, I think it will work out for you.
